Community participation as the core of primary health care

ABSTRACT

In Cuba, the community is important as a setting for popular participation, it is strengthened through the organization of the community. The health teams, together with the representatives of the sectors involved in carrying out the health-care projects, materialize their implementation. The authors analyzed several bibliographies with the aim of socializing some concepts and ways of interacting with their members to prepare the tasks that strengthen community work, among them: the identification of leaders and learning needs, the elaboration of a comprehensive analysis of the health situation, the development of social communication strategies, the application of the participatory research-action method for the solution of the problems, the systematic evaluation of the proposed actions and the impact on the health levels of the population.
